to be near, i.e. at hand; neuter present participle (singular) time being, or (plural) property Derivation: from G3844 and G1510 (including its various forms);
KJV Usage: come, X have, be here, + lack, (be here) present.
πάρ-ειμι [in LXX for בּוֹא, etc. ;] __1. to be by, at hand or present; __(a) of persons: Rev.17:8; παρών (opp. to ἀπών), Refs 1Co.5:3, 2Co.10:2 10:11 13:2 13:10; before ἐπί with genitive, Act.24:19; ἐνώπιον, Act.10:33; ἐνθάδε, Act.17:6; πρός, with accusative of person(s), Refs Act.12:20, 2Co.11:8, Gal.4:18, 20; __(b) of things : of time, ὁ καιρός, Jhn.7:6; τ. παρόν, Heb.12:11; ἡ ἀλήθεια, 2Pe.1:12; ταῦτα, 2Pe.1:9; τ. παρόντα, Heb.13:5. __2. to have come or arrived (Hdt., Thuc., al.; see Field, Notes, 65) : Refs Luk.13:1, Jhn.11:28, Act.10:21; before εἰς, Col.1:6; before ἐπί, with accusative of thing(s), Mat.26:50 (cf. συν-πάρειμι).† (AS)
Thayer:
1) to be by, be at hand, to have arrived, to be present 2) to be ready, in store, at command
